Putting on Christ

To Christians in the churches of Galatia Paul said, "For you are all sons of God through faith in Christ Jesus. For as many of you as were baptized into Christ have put on Christ" (Gal. 3:26-27).

It has been said that you cannot put on a coat unless you first get into it. This is a true statement, and could be said of many things (such as putting on gloves, a pair of pants, etc.). Suppose Paul was talking about blue jeans, and he said, “For you are all jeans wearers. For as many of you as got into jeans have put on jeans.” By this statement, would you have any trouble understanding that you cannot put on a pair of blue jeans without getting into them first? Speaking by the revelation of Christ (Gal. 1:11-12) Paul says that in order to put on Christ we must be baptized into Him. Our faith is proven by our obedience (James 2:22, 26; cf. Heb. 11:7), and that is how we become sons of God “through faith.”

The written work titled, “The Bible Illustrator,” tells of two friends who went for a boat ride. The boat upset, and the river was swift and deep. The man to whom the boat belonged had taken two life jackets along. He said “I put one on, but my friend laid his down beside him. When we were thrown into the river, my life jacket soon brought me to the top, but my friend never came up again.”

Friends, Christ is our Life jacket. If we do not put Him on, we cannot be saved (cf. 1 Pet. 3:20-21; Mk. 16:16). So then, friends, have you put Him on yet?
